| Objective:This study through established the model of rats with severe abdominal infection,comparing the activity of diamine oxidase(DAO) and the concentration of D-lactic acid in plasma,and the pathological change of terminal ileum were observed and graded under optical microscope,to explore the possible protective effect of taurine on intestinactionl mucosal barrier function in rats with severe abdominal infection.Methods:Because a higher mortality was expected with cecal ligation and puncture(CLP),Sixty-six SD males rats were randomly divided into three groups:control group(Group C n=18),abdominal infection group(Group I n=24)and taurine treatment group(Group T n=24).The rats of group C were only slightly changed the cecal several times before definitive abdominal closure.The rats in group I and group T were established by CLP.The rats in group T received intraperitoneal injection of taurine(200mg/kg)immediately after the operation,however,the rats in group C and group I received intraperitoneal injection of equivoluminal normal saline.Six rats in group C were randomly picked up at 6,12,24 h after operation,eight rats in group I and group T were randomly picked up at 6,12,24 h after operation to have the activity of diamine oxidase(DAO) and the concentration of D-lactic acid in plasma measured.The pathological change of terminal ileum were observed and graded.Results:(1)Serum DAO activity: Main effect of both grouping factors and time factors had statistically significant(P<0.05),and there was no interaction between grouping factors and time factors(P > 0.05).According to the consequence of pairwise comparison,the comparison between different groups and different time had statistically significant(P<0.05).The activity of DAO was significantly higher of the group I than that of group T,which was higher than that of group C at the same point of time(P<0.05).(2)Serum D-lactic acid concentration:Main effect of both grouping factors and time factors had statistically significant(P < 0.05),and there was no interaction between grouping factors and time factors(P> 0.05).According to the consequence of pairwise comparison,the comparison between different groups and different time had statistically significant(P<0.05). The concentration of D-lactic acid was significantly higher of the group I than that of group T,which was higher than that of group C at the same point of time(P<0.05).(3) Pathological injury classification of ileum mucosa:Main effect of both grouping factors and time factors had statistically significant(P < 0.05),and there was no interaction between grouping factors and time factors(P > 0.05).According to the consequence of pairwise comparison,the comparison between different groups and different time had statistically significant(P < 0.05).The grade of pathological injury classification of ileum mucosa was significantly higher of the group I than that of group T,which was higher than that of group C at the same point of time(P<0.05).Conclusion:Taurine has a certain protective effect on intestinal mucosal barrier function in rats with severe abdominal infection. |
